About the role

Employer: United Services Automobile Association Tasks: Identifies and manages existing and emerging risks that stem from business activities and the job role. Ensures risks associated with business activities are effectively identified, measured, monitored, and controlled. Follows written risk and compliance policies and procedures for business activities. Leads, facilitates and/or collaborates with cross functional teams and vendors in support of the end-to-end research project(s). Determines the appropriate research methodologies, design innovation, marketing strategies and general industry trends to solve business problems within specific areas of expertise. Applies advanced level of knowledge in conducting research using the appropriate methodology (quantitative, qualitative, text or business intelligence). Examples include surveys, usability tests, focus groups, in-depth interviews, and ethnographical studies. Formulates findings into business recommendations and presents findings to various levels of leadership. Mentors and provides guidance to peers and team members; navigates through obstacles to resolve escalated issues of an unusual nature. Researches and identifies industry best practices and trends to increase effectiveness. Acquires, maintains, and applies advanced knowledge of the business, its products and processes, and advanced knowledge of qualitative or quantitative research methodologies to represent member sentiment across products, channels, and experiences. May allow for partial telecommuting. Requirements: Employer will accept a degree in Bachelor's Degree in Finance, Marketing, Economics, Statistics or related field and 6 years of post baccalaureate experience in the job offered or related occupation. Alternatively, employer will accept a Master's degree in Finance, Marketing, Economics, Statistics or related field and 4 years of experience in the job offered or related occupation. Quantitative and qualitative research methodologies: survey design and analysis, focus groups, in-depth interviews, ethnographic studies, usability testing, and customer experience research; Statistical testing and modeling: Z-tests, T-tests, ANOVA, linear/logistic regression, correlation analysis using SAS Enterprise Guide, Python (pandas, stats models, and scikit-learn), and SPSS; Database management and integration: Microsoft Access, Excel, SQL, and Snowflake, supporting end-to-end analytical workflows including data extraction, transformation, and loading (ETL); Qualtrics XM for survey programming, distribution, and analytics; Qualtrics XM's Text iQ for unstructured text and sentiment analysis; Tableau and Power BI for dashboard development, trend analysis, and reporting; and Knowledge of research compliance and data governance, including risk management, regulatory standards, data privacy protocols, and ethical research practices Worksite: 9800 Fredericksburg Road, San Antonio, TX 78288 Relocation assistance is Not Available for this position.
